The lifespan of a "Robbie" is notoriously short. As the boy hits puberty, his bone structure softens or expands, his voice drops, and the "old soul" innocence is replaced by teenage awkwardness. Agencies typically have a 2-to-3-year window to monetize the "Robbie" before deciding whether he will transition into a traditional male model (a difficult leap, as adult menswear requires a completely different physical proportions) or exit the industry entirely.
